I’ve been trying to build data science library pyarrow (the arrow library, for parquet files mainly in my case) for PyPy. I’ve gotten it working for pypy2 a few years ago, and is now trying for PyPy3. Overall I get it to build and produce a pyarrow wheel file by following the arrow instructions. So far so good. I expect a massive part of pyarrow not to work, but for my case I really only need `pandas.read_parquet`. However I am stuck trying to figure out how to use the pyppy cpyext for Datetime.
The code I’m trying to build is:
Which is basically:
| PyDateTime_CAPI* datetime_api = nullptr; |
|
|
| void InitDatetime() { |
| PyAcquireGIL lock; |
| datetime_api = |
| reinterpret_cast<PyDateTime_CAPI*>(PyCapsule_Import(PyDateTime_CAPSULE_NAME, 0)); |
| if (datetime_api == nullptr) { |
| Py_FatalError("Could not import datetime C API"); |
| } |
| } |
I’ve tried about a million different ways, but I’m way outside my comfort zone :) I can get it to build by doing:
datetime_api = PyDateTimeAPI;
And also:
datetime_api = reinterpret_cast<PyDateTime_CAPI*>(PyCapsule_Import("datetime", 0));
And:
datetime_api = reinterpret_cast<PyDateTime_CAPI*>(PyCapsule_Import("datetime.datetime_CAPI", 0));
But both of these trigger the fatal error in the code after (“could not import date time C API” or "PyCapsule_Import "datetime" is not valid” or module 'datetime' has no attribute 'datetime_CAPI')
